Role Summary
The Release Train Engineer (RTE) is a servant leader and coach for the Agile Release Train (ART). The RTE facilitates ART events and processes, manages risks and dependencies, and helps drive delivery excellence while ensuring strong communication with client senior leadership.
Key Responsibilities
- Act as the servant leader for the Agile Release Train and facilitate ART-level ceremonies (PI Planning, Scrum of Scrums, System Demos, Inspect & Adapt, etc.).
- Manage and resolve cross-team dependencies, risks, and impediments.
- Coordinate release planning and execution across multiple agile teams.
- Drive alignment across Product Management, Engineering, Architecture, and Business stakeholders.
- Ensure effective communication with client senior leadership, providing clear status, risks, and mitigation plans.
- Track and report ART-level metrics (predictability, velocity, quality, etc.).
- Coach teams on SAFe/Agile best practices and continuous improvement.
- Support change management and help teams adopt agile ways of working.
